
Episode #22
IG Scroll: Is Sharing Reels a Love Language?
Instagram's algorithm took over the show again, and this one's a chaotic ride through everything currently living in the feed. There's a street interview response about fat people and plane tickets that gets more unhinged with every line, a viral story about a woman who ran three full-time jobs at once and ranked in the top 10% at every single one, and an ongoing debate about what actually counts as illegal versus what just gets you fired. On the fitness side, the scroll delivers some real talk too: protein brownies that taste like dried-out cat, why 180 grams of protein a day isn't necessary unless there's a bodybuilding show on the calendar, and the difference between wanting “Pilates arms” and just wanting muscle. There's also a debate worth having about whether weight loss and quality of life are actually two separate things or just two sides of the same coin. Add in a Florida man who wore 11 shirts through airport security to dodge a bag fee and a woman who faked not speaking English for six years until trivia night blew her cover, and it's another reminder that the internet never runs out of material.
